About BMW K 1300 R
October 15, 2015: Back in 2008, BMW Motorrad introduced an iconic German-born machine named as BMW K1300. The manufacturer offers it in two variants - K1300R & K1300S. The suffixes R and S denote Roadster and Sport respectively. Both the variants are totally different from each other in terms of their engine capacities and categories. BMW K1300R roadster comes equipped with an 1170cc engine that pumps out 125 bhp of power and 125 Nm of torque. On the other hand, its sportier version houses a 1293cc engine that generates a peak power of 175 bhp with 140 Nm of maximum torque. Furthermore, these bikes are bestowed with some handy optional characteristics as well like, ABS, heated grips, Akrapovic exhaust and a quick shifter. BMW K 1300 is available across the Indian dealerships in the price range of Rs. 19.50 lac to Rs. 21.80 lac (ex-showroom, Delhi).

K 1300 R Expert Review
BMW Motorrad, the famous motorcycle manufacturer, introduced this sports bike in India. Christened as BMW K 1300 S, it is the second most powerful bike in sports bike category after BMW S 1000RR. The manufacturer has given this bike both sports and touring characteristics that are evident in its comfortable riding position and inevitable performance of the engine. With high-end features and irresistible design, this machine is simply havoc and leaves the audience speechless.
BMW K 1300 S is offered in two shades, which are Titanium Silver Metallic with Sapphire Black Metallic and Sapphire Black Metallic with Dark Graphite Metallic. The equipment that make it a premium motorcycle are tinted windshield, automatic stability control, HP carbon front mudguard, HP carbon tank cover, tank bag, luggage grid with sports panniers, rear spray guard, HP instrument cluster, center stand and HP gearshift assist. The ride of the motorcycle is made better with heated grips, electronic tyre pressure control and Electronic Suspension Adjustment
BMW K 1300 S is powered by a 1293cc, water-cooled, 4-stroke, DOHC, in-line four-cylinder engine that is mated to a 6-speed constant mesh transmission. The motor is tuned to produce an impressive power output of 175bhp at 9,250rpm with a peak torque of 140Nm at 8,250rpm. The top speed of the bike is above 200kmph while it can return a mileage of around 17kmpl. The fuel tank capacity of the machine is 19 liter wherein 4 liter goes in reserve.
BMW K 1300 S is enveloped on a Bridge-type frame with engine as a stressed member. The suspension at the front is aBMW Motorrad Duolever with central spring strut and the rear is equipped to a cast aluminum single-sided swing arm with BMW Motorrad Paralever with central spring strut with a lever system. Tyres moving its body are 120/70 ZR 17 at the front and 190/55 ZR 17 at the rear. Encircling aluminum cast alloy wheels, these tyres get halted with the help of front 320mm dual disc with 4-piston fixed calipers and a rear 320mm disc with a double-piston caliper. The braking is further responsive with the addition of Anti-lock brake system.
